메뉴 바로가기 검색 및 카테고리 바로가기

한빛미디어

뇌를 자극하는 java 프로그래밍

뇌를 자극하는 java 프로그래밍 질의응답 게시판입니다.

인터페이스의 의미와 사용목적에 대하여 질문 드립니다.

2008-05-02

|

by 자바

2512

1. 우선 추상클래스와 인터페이스의 뚜렸한 차이점을 잘 모르겠구요..

2. 인터페이스에서 멤버변수 부분을 왜 static final로 설정해야 하는지 잘 이해가 안갑니다.
   굳이 왜 멤버변수 부분을 어떤 의미에서 static final로 정의하는지요..
   객체를 만들수 없기때문에 그렇다고 이해하긴 먼가 좀 애매한거 같고.. 어떤 원리에 의해서
   static final이 되는 건가요?

3. 마지막으로 인터페이스의 의미와 사용목적을 설명을 좀 해주셨으면 합니다.

4. static 클래스의 의미가 잘 이해가 안되네요.

5. 그리고 static final 변수가 프로그램 어디서나 사용할수 있다는데.. 언뜻 잘 이해가 안갑니다.
   설명을 좀 부탁드려요.

답변 부탁드리겠습니다. ^^
댓글 입력
자료실